New devices borrow E Ink; here’s whats next

by JG Mason on May 12, 2008 at 03:23 PM

E Ink device by Delphi

Here is how to take the ubiquitous car remote and bring new ideas to it.  Add in a screen with Kindle-like E Ink and you’ve got a notice you are low on gas, maybe your tires are low, or your oil life is nearly depleted.  This is just one of the cool things ultra low power E Ink can bring.

This specific device by Delphi, allows users to locate their vehicle in a sea of look-a-likes; turn on the car, adjust the climate in the car, and more.  Interesting and fun, who doesn’t love that?  Delphi says in volume, E Ink device can be made economically. 

The flexible shape of the E-Ink screen means this kind of innovation is coming to more and more devices like microwaves, refrigerators and remotes.  Where else would you love to have a simple screen for data?
